Power Racing Series needs your help

Power Racing Series launched a Kickstarter campaign on September 20, 2011 to raise $20,000 in funds to cover their increased travel expenses, provide a more accurate timing and safety systems and increase the amount of races for the 2012 season. i3 Detroit gets visit by local celebrity

Stephen Clark, WXYZ News Anchor, stopped by with his wife to customize a floor plank for a home remodel he is working on. We used the laser cutter to etch the following quote into a plank; “If you’re lucky enough to live on a lake… then you’re lucky enough – The Clark Family, Summer 2011” […]
